What does it really take to build lasting wealth?
In this episode, Loral Langemeier shares her proven wealth building framework and introduces her wealth cycle, showing how entrepreneurs generate income, protect it through strategic tax planning, and reinvest it into appreciating assets. Along the way, she challenges common misconceptions about passive income, explains why integrated financial planning matters, and shares how mentorship, education, and taking action accelerate wealth building.
Whether you're just getting started or trying to grow your existing business, this episode provides practical insights to help you create a long-term wealth building plan that actually works.

Loral Langemeier:Yep, yep. And I wrote it all here. I'm going
Loral Langemeier:to give everybody a book of my Millionaire Maker. Last year was
Loral Langemeier:my 25th anniversary, so it's now version two with 40 more
Loral Langemeier:families in the back. So yeah, 47 families to kind of compare
Loral Langemeier:your progress to. But the journey starts with an initial
Loral Langemeier:assessment. I call it a gap analysis of where are you and
Loral Langemeier:what do you want that identifies you know because some people
Loral Langemeier:their start is they have a lot of lazy assets they have a 401k
Loral Langemeier:that's not performing RSP in Canada so they either have you
Loral Langemeier:know real estate that's not performing so do they start
Loral Langemeier:there do they start with corporate structure to reduce
Loral Langemeier:their taxes or like you said do they start with that cash
Loral Langemeier:machine to go generate new income, so it's usually one of
Loral Langemeier:those categories we we address first. I always make sure the
Loral Langemeier:foundation on tax, corporate structure, trusts like they're
Loral Langemeier:solid because why build a bunch of wealth on a you know house of
Loral Langemeier:sand as they call it, which most people have. So while our teams
Loral Langemeier:are actually doing that work, we are either one of two ways:
Loral Langemeier:where they're helping them come up with money rules and a
Loral Langemeier:diversity plan for their assets, or they're doing their income.
Loral Langemeier:And if they do income, like they'll get back to their
Loral Langemeier:assets, but they don't have enough income to even buy proper
Loral Langemeier:assets. So you know you got to generate income to then use that
Loral Langemeier:active income to go buy passive assets. That's what I call the

Loral Langemeier:Yeah, I do. I'm, and I always say I'm. I
Loral Langemeier:think taxes are prescriptive, but here's how taxes are treated
Loral Langemeier:in the segregated model is there's kind of two points I
Loral Langemeier:want to make. Number one, it's segregated intentionally, and
Loral Langemeier:the way that tax has been educated and informed in the
Loral Langemeier:world is just that damn form you have to fill out in America by
Loral Langemeier:April 15th and in Canada by I think it's June 30th. I don't
Loral Langemeier:remember. Like I know that's Australians, but you have this
Loral Langemeier:tax year end, and then you hand all your box of stuff
Loral Langemeier:metaphorically. It could be a file to a CPA or any content,
Loral Langemeier:and then they do what you did. So basically, they're a
Loral Langemeier:historian. They're just recording your history. They're
Loral Langemeier:not sitting with you as a strategist saying, "Okay, Zach,
Loral Langemeier:how much you're going to make in the next 12 months? Let's keep
Loral Langemeier:more of. You're going to make a million bucks. Let's keep
Loral Langemeier:900,000 of it, and let's use that for your own wealth
Loral Langemeier:building. And honestly, with our tax teams all over the world,
